社区讨论

关于第一条题解为什么能AC这件事

P1168中位数参与者 1已保存回复 0

讨论操作

快速查看讨论及其快照的属性,并进行相关操作。

当前回复
0 条
当前快照
1 份
快照标识符
@lqgg0eap
此快照首次捕获于
2023/12/22 17:42
2 年前
此快照最后确认于
2023/12/22 17:42
2 年前
查看原帖
如题。 代码见题解
vector的insert复杂度理论为O(n),所以这个程序的复杂度实际上是O(n²)。但是实测跑了好几遍后测出来insert的复杂度(全部从头部插入,即最差情况下)为O(n/150)(非标准写法),也就是这个程序的时间复杂度是O(n²/150)。最大能过到200000,300000就不行了,题目恰好100000,所以能AC。第一条题解算是卡常数的做法了(

回复

0 条回复,欢迎继续交流。

正在加载回复...